Tech Tips
After confirming that DTC P0A38-257 or P0A39-259 is output, use the GTS to check "Motor Temp No2" in the Data List.
| Displayed Temperature | Malfunction |
|---|---|
| -40°C (-40°F) | Open circuit or short to +B |
| 215°C (419°F) | Short circuit or short to ground |

CHECK CONNECTOR CONNECTION CONDITION (GENERATOR TEMPERATURE SENSOR CONNECTOR)
Check the connection condition of the generator temperature sensor connector and the contact pressure of each terminal. Check the terminals for deformation, and check the connector for water ingress and foreign matter.
| OK |
|---|
| - The connector is connected securely. |
| - The terminals are not deformed and are connected securely. |
| - No water or foreign matter in the connector. |
